While clearing out the junk on my property that the previous owners left behind I put aside all the aluminum that I found. In the end I had 127kg of scrap aluminum. I sort the aluminum in grade I and grade II. Grade I are cast aluminum parts. This means that this alloy is more suited for casting resulting in less shrinkage and deformation everything else goes in Grade II.
To melt the 127kg it took me roughly 4 hours and each ingot weighs roughly 10kg
